Bel DonovanBel Donovan
This hotel does not live up the the quality you'd expect from a Wyndham location. There were several things that left a lot to be desired. First, there were several issues with electrical outlets(one didn't work at all, another was falling out of the wall, and the one in the bathroom had a random metal object lodged in it). The next issue was the cleanliness of the room, there was a random stain on the bedside lamp shade, the carpet was dirty, and in the bathroom there was dust and mold behind the wallpaper that was peeling off. The next issue was their pools, which were boasted about on their sign. The sign out front of the hotel stated they have an indoor pool, but it was not able to be used as it and the connected hot tub were both empty. The outdoor pool was able to be used, but it was in severe need of a cleaning. Another problem is that the breakfast, which is included in your stay, was very lacking. The breakfast options were extremely limited and stale, additionally the refrigerator that is supposed to hold the milk for cereal and yogurts was not working so they just threw a couple of each item in a small container with ice. The last issue was the staff, first off they were not welcoming but worse yet when you walked by their office near the front desk all that could be smelled was a very strong odor of marijuana. The only good thing about this hotel is that it's well located (but there are many other options available on the same street). Overall, I would never recommend this location to anyone.

I will start with the positive, the hotel location is phenomenal. The hotel is beautiful (from a distance), however, immediately upon entering the hotel a moldy smell slaps you across the face. If you look at the vents you can see the black mold seeping through and around specially the vent in front of the elevator. Our room key failed to work almost every time requiring us to have to go back to the lobby and have it reset. Our room was facing the the majestic water fountain that is desperately in need of a power wash and clean water YUCK! The room doors need to be pushed and pulled extremely hard, therefore our sleep was continuously interrupted when the neighboring guest entered or left their rooms. The other reviews are correct, the remote to the tv only allows for you to change the channel, no power no volume control the towels were stained and despite putting up room service sign our room was not serviced. The phone did not work, no mini fridge or microwave in the rooms and when we asked for a follow up on our request for one we were met with attitude. The AC discharged a mildewy smell as well but not as bad as the lobby central air. The breakfast is not worth your time. Coffee was weak, eggs were oily and the other accompaniments were just sad. The toaster tripped the power overtime the two toasters were used simultaneously. The dinning area smelled of..... you guessed it MORE MOLD! This hotel houses two enormous pools one indoor and one outdoor, and to say they were filthy is an understatement. Part of the outdoor pool floor was green and the indoor pool water was foggy. I guess after guest complained and the outdoor pool was later closed for water testing.

I made the reservation with the surprise booking feature on Priceline. We selected a three star Hotel and we were assigned this one. We were excited to get such a deal, but we got what we paid for this was no deal. We paid a 1.5 or 2 star hotel price and that is what we received. This hotel does have GREAT potential with some updates and elbow grease I'm sure it can be restored to its former glory, so please be mindful if you are booking this one. I fail to understand the 5 star reviews, this is not the worst hotel but definitely not a 3+. I suggest ignore the great reviews and read the negative ones as you will be able to see the full story....
